Locksmiths and Safe Repairers Salary in Idaho
SOC 49-9094 · Idaho · BLS OEWS May 2024
The median salary for Locksmiths and Safe Repairers in Idaho is $46,301 per year ($22.26/hr). This is 8.3% lower than the national median of $50,482. The middle 50% earn between $37,066 and $56,035 annually. Top earners at the 90th percentile reach $76,086.
Wage Percentiles: Idaho
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Annual Salary | vs National |
|---|---|---|---|
| P10 | $17.53 | $36,462 | +4.9% |
| P25 | $17.82 | $37,066 | -8.8% |
| P50MEDIAN | $22.26 | $46,301 | -8.3% |
| P75 | $26.94 | $56,035 | -12.9% |
| P90 | $36.58 | $76,086 | -4.1% |
